CAREER: Revealing the Interplay of Spin and Charge Degrees of Freedom in Iron Complexes With Redox Active Ligands

Organization Regents of the University of IdahoLocation MOSCOW, United StatesPosted 1 Aug 2025Deadline 31 Jul 2030
